About agriculture in Kodiodougou

Located in the Woroba District of Côte d’Ivoire, Kodiodougou is situated within a landscape characterized by a transition from forest to wooded savannah. The rural surroundings feature rolling terrain with scattered clusters of trees and traditional settlements, reflecting the typical geography of the country's northern-central interior.

The agricultural sector in Kodiodougou is dominated by the production of cashew nuts, which serve as a primary cash crop for local farmers. Additionally, the fertile soil supports the cultivation of food crops such as yams, maize, and cassava. Livestock farming, particularly cattle and small ruminants, is also an integral part of the local rural economy.

Agronomists and farm workers visiting the area can expect seasonal peaks during the cashew harvest and cotton picking periods. Employment opportunities often revolve around plantation management, crop processing, and technical support for smallholder cooperatives. The environment requires adaptability to tropical conditions and a focus on improving yield through modern agricultural practices.
